Dawn Zuidgeest-Craft always wanted to be a doctor, but life seemed to have other plans for her. During her younger years, Dawn finished her undergraduate degree and eventually became a neonatal nurse practitioner.
She explained in an essay that after her divorce at 35, she applied to medical school but was denied admission. Dawn married for the second time and had two more children, her youngest born when she was 49.
Although her career and motherhood fulfilled her, her desire to attend medical school remained burning inside.
When her husband suffered a medical emergency, she took that as a sign. In her late 60s, Dawn decided to take the leap.
Dawn Zuidgeest-Craft used savings earmarked for her retirement to attend a medical school in the Caribbean. She’ll begin her residency at a Michigan hospital in July.
Meteorologist Ginger Zee isn’t just Dawn Zuidgeest-Craft’s daughter; she’s also her biggest fan. She told Entertainment Tonight her mother’s conviction makes her proud every single day.
“I always say with tornadoes and meteorology, that when you go to school for it, it’s one thing, but when you storm chase, it’s another,” she said. “That’s how you learn how to be a great meteorologist.”
Ginger added that because her mom has such an extensive medical background, this will be perfect for her.
“And I always use the analogy that if you had a doctor who had never worked on a patient before, you wouldn’t want that doctor, if they were only from a textbook,” she added. “She already had 45 years of being in the hospital setting.”
Dawn Zuidgeest-Craft can’t wait to get started.
“When you have to do it for work … you feel like, ‘I got to do this so that I can pay my rent,’” Dawn told reporters. “I want to do this because I really enjoy this.”
